### Runbook: Report export timezone mismatches (Glimmerfield)

If a customer reports that exported totals differ from the dashboard, check whether their report schedule predates the March cutover — older schedules still render in server-local time rather than the account timezone. Re-saving the schedule fixes it. Before escalating, confirm the export worker is running with the expected timezone settings shown below.

config for kadup-kajog:
[raldor]
host = raldor.tolvaqworks.internal
user = raldor_svc
database = raldor_prod

# Settings for the Tollgate shipping-fee rules engine.
# New folks: rules live in the `fee_rules` table and are evaluated top-down
# by priority; the first matching rule wins. Weight bands, destination zones,
# and carrier surcharges are all expressed as JSON conditions. Edits go
# through the admin console, never raw SQL — the console writes an audit row
# for each change. The engine caches rules for five minutes, so expect a
# short delay after updates. The engine reads rules from the database via
# the connection string that follows.

primary connection of kahof-kagep = mssql://belath_svc:3uqY4g6LHG5Nyi@db-d0ba.ferralabs.corp:5432/rusdor

# Build Provenance: Monthly Partition Tables

All partitioned tables in Corvid's ledger store split by calendar month. Partitions are created two months ahead by the `part-roller` job. If a write lands outside an existing partition, ingestion halts — do not create partitions by hand; rerun `part-roller` with the target month. Provenance for each partition DDL is recorded in the Attestor log, keyed by the roller run. Verify the run before unblocking ingestion. The attested build token for the current roller release follows.

session token of yajof-bagef = htk4_937d

Ticket: staging exports stuck — misconfigured env on Brackenport worker

Failed exports aren't retrying on staging. Root cause: the worker box was provisioned from the old Fenwick template, so retry settings never made it into the env file. Exports fail once and die silently. Fix: set `EXPORT_RETRY_ENABLED=true` and `EXPORT_RETRY_MAX=5`, then restart the queue consumer. The retry scheduler also refuses to start without its queue auth secret, so append that directly below this line.

sealed setting: ARCHIVE_KEY3=8d0